Rowlett's rental market has grown significantly with new construction near Sapphire Bay and the DART station. Here's the honest breakdown.
Newer complexes (built after 2018):
-
The Sapphire (Sapphire Bay area)
- Built: 2022
- Price: 1BR $1,400-1,600 / 2BR $1,800-2,200
- Pros: Newest in Rowlett. Modern finishes. Pool is resort-quality. Walkable to Sapphire Bay boardwalk and restaurants. Maintenance is responsive.
- Cons: Most expensive in Rowlett. Thin walls — you will hear your neighbors. Parking garage fills up by 8pm on weekends (visitors competing with residents).
- Rating: 4.2/5 (Google)

Station at Rowlett (near DART station)
- Built: 2019
- Price: 1BR $1,250-1,450 / 2BR $1,600-1,900
- Pros: Walking distance to DART Blue Line. If you commute to downtown, this is the play. Good gym. Responsive management.
- Cons: Train noise is noticeable in units facing the tracks. Not as much nearby retail/dining as Sapphire Bay area.
- Rating: 4.0/5 (Google)
Mid-range complexes:
-
Villas at Rowlett Creek
- Price: 1BR $1,100-1,300 / 2BR $1,400-1,650
- Pros: Quiet location near Rowlett Creek. Good value for the size. Pool is decent. No train noise.
- Cons: Older appliances in some units. Management turnover has led to inconsistent maintenance response times. Some residents report pest issues in ground-floor units.
- Rating: 3.7/5 (Google)

Lakeview Apartments (Lakeview Pkwy area)
- Price: 1BR $1,050-1,250 / 2BR $1,300-1,550
- Pros: Central Rowlett location. Close to Kroger, restaurants, and 66/PGBT access. Affordable for the area.
- Cons: Dated interiors. Pool is small. Parking lot is poorly lit at night. Some reviews mention slow maintenance.
- Rating: 3.4/5 (Google)
Budget options:
- Older complexes along 66 corridor
- Price: 1BR $850-1,050 / 2BR $1,100-1,300
- Pros: Cheapest rent in Rowlett. Month-to-month leases sometimes available.
- Cons: Older construction, less maintained, some have pest/mold issues reported in reviews. Read Google reviews carefully before signing.
- Rating: Varies widely, 2.5-3.5/5
What to know about renting in Rowlett:
- Average rent has increased 22% since 2021. Source: Apartments.com
- Most complexes require proof of income (3x rent) and credit check
- Pet deposits are typically $300-500 with $25-50/month pet rent
- Renter's insurance is required at most complexes ($15-25/month through most providers)
Renter's rights in Texas:
- Security deposit must be returned within 30 days with itemized deductions. See my Texas law post for details.
- Landlord must make repairs within a "reasonable time" after written notice. Texas Property Code Section 92.052.
- You can terminate a lease for uninhabitable conditions (no AC in Texas summer = uninhabitable).
